    As White Queen of the HFC she was your basic villain doing and saying basic villainous things. I loved her back then because she was so different to Shaw and the others at the time with her own distinct voice and motives (mainly as a New Mutants rogue). The trauma of losing her Hellions then being cast in the role of teacher/protector of the Gen-X students really added some beauty-full layers and complexity to her character which were solidified when she became a full-fledged X-Man later on under Morrison (my favourite) and Fraction and Whedon (admittedly not my favourite iterations of the character).
    What I love about this era's Emma is that she is one of the few characters who feels truly three-dimensional because she still carries all those elements from her past (even the villain mindset) into this present.

    What I like about Emma is her story involves changes but feels linear. (Which a slight derailment with IvX). She also has impact on the franchise which has seem to grown; perhaps to a boil now in the Hickman era. In a series about evolution; she's evolved; and I'd argue generally for the bigger and better.

    She's a yin to a lot of yangs within X-Men:
    - Wolverine is hyper masculine, Emma is hyper femme
    - Jean is emotional; Emma is intellectual
    - Kitty's creating a new system; Emma working within the current system
    - Iceman's insecure bottom; Emma is a power bottom
    - Xavier teaches his dream; Emma teaches practicality

    She has a lot of ties to the larger Marvel Universe: House of M, Civil War, Secret Invasion, Age of Ultron, Original Sin, Secret Empire. Namor, Iron Man, Kingpin, Invisible Woman, Doom, Captain America.

    The Hickman era has really brought on her family back with the Cuckoos and Christian as well.
